How is the diagnosis of dirofilariasis in cats performed? Serology Chest radiographs Echocardiography The most useful diagnostic tests for filariasis are serology, chest radiographs, and echocardiography. The diagnosis of feline filariasis is more difficult in cats than in dogs and can be easily overlooked. The presence of a systolic murmur can be detected during auscultation. The use of both antigen and antibody detection tests increases the likelihood of making a good diagnosis. Microfilaremia is rarely seen in circulating blood.
